HB 97 Georgia House · 2021-2022 Regular Session

Courts; oath for certain clerks of the probate court; require and provide

Summary
A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Article 2 of Chapter 9 of Title 15 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, relating to jurisdiction, power, and duties, so as to require and to provide for an oath for certain clerks of the probate court; to provide for related matters;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.
